Egyptian Cotton Towels

You'll love the luxurious feel of Egyptian cotton towels after washing them. Compared to other cotton towels, Egyptian cotton towels are known for their exceptional softness and durability. The secret lies in the long and fine fibers of Egyptian cotton, which create a smoother and more absorbent fabric.

Unlike regular cotton towels, Egyptian cotton towels become even softer and fluffier with each wash, making them a long-lasting investment. The benefits of Egyptian cotton towels extend beyond their softness. They're highly absorbent, quickly wicking away moisture from your skin. Additionally, they're resistant to pilling and fading, ensuring that your towels will maintain their quality and vibrant colors for years to come.

Microfiber Towels

When it comes to finding the softest bath towels after washing, you can't go wrong with microfiber towels. Microfiber towels have gained popularity due to their numerous benefits.

Firstly, microfiber towels are incredibly soft and gentle on the skin, providing a luxurious feel every time you use them.

Secondly, they're highly absorbent, capable of drying you off quickly and efficiently.

Additionally, microfiber towels are lightweight and compact, making them perfect for travel or outdoor activities.

To ensure that your microfiber towels remain soft and plush, it's important to follow proper care instructions.

Start by washing them separately from other fabrics to prevent lint transfer.

Use a mild detergent and avoid fabric softeners, as they can leave a residue that reduces the towel's absorbency.

It's best to air dry the towels or tumble dry them on low heat to maintain their softness.

Turkish Towels

If you want the softest bath towels after washing, try using Turkish towels as they're known for their luxurious feel and exceptional softness. Turkish towels, also known as peshtemal or hammam towels, have been used for centuries in Turkish baths and are gaining popularity worldwide.

Here are some benefits of Turkish towels compared to regular towels:

  • Absorbency: Turkish towels are made from premium quality cotton that becomes more absorbent with each wash. They can quickly absorb moisture, making them perfect for drying your body or hair.
  • Lightweight and compact: Turkish towels are thinner and lighter than regular towels, making them easy to carry and pack. Whether you're going to the beach, gym, or traveling, Turkish towels are a space-saving option.
  • Quick-drying: Turkish towels dry much faster than regular towels due to their lightweight and loose weave. They won't stay damp for long, preventing musty odors and bacteria growth.

Pima Cotton Towels

For the softest bath towels after washing, consider using Pima cotton towels, known for their exceptional softness and durability. Pima cotton is a high-quality cotton that's grown primarily in the United States. It's often compared to Egyptian cotton, another luxurious option. While both types of cotton are known for their softness, Pima cotton has longer fibers, which results in a smoother and more durable towel.

Pima cotton towels also have excellent absorbency, making them perfect for drying off after a bath or shower. In addition to their softness and absorbency, Pima cotton towels are also resistant to shrinking and fading, ensuring that they'll maintain their quality wash after wash.

Combed Cotton Towels

For a towel that's exceptionally soft and durable, but won't break the bank, consider opting for combed cotton towels. Combed cotton is a type of cotton that goes through an extra step in the manufacturing process, where the shorter fibers are removed, leaving only the longer, stronger fibers. This results in a towel that isn't only softer, but also more resistant to wear and tear.

Some benefits of combed cotton towels include:

  • Enhanced softness: The removal of shorter fibers makes combed cotton towels incredibly soft and plush.
  • Increased durability: Combed cotton towels are more durable and long-lasting compared to regular cotton towels.
  • Excellent absorbency: Combed cotton fibers have a higher absorbency rate, making these towels great at drying you off quickly.

Waffle Weave Towels

Looking for a towel that's both soft and textured? Try using waffle weave towels for a cozy and exfoliating experience. Waffle weave towels are known for their unique weave pattern that creates a textured surface, making them great for gentle exfoliation. The waffle design also allows for better absorption and quick drying, making these towels perfect for everyday use.
